Warriors Overcome Deficit, Score Five Runs In The Ninth For Win

Clarksville, Ark.-The Eagles let a 9-5 lead slip away in the ninth inning as Hendrix College pulled out a 10-9 win Tuesday afternoon. After the Eagles scored three runs on a bases clearing double from Taber Childs, the Eagles headed into the ninth to secure the game. However, Hendrix battled to load the bases with one out. From there, the Warriors were hit by a pitch and then flew out. With two outs, the Warriors didn’t give up as they drew another bases loaded walk to bring the score to 9-7. The Warriors delivered a bases clearing double of their own to move ahead. The Eagles built a 4-1 lead after two innings of play. In the sixth, Jackson Baker hit a two-run homer. The Eagles outhit the Warriors 15-8. Dru Didway, Brooks Boshers and Childs each went 3-for-5.
